Description
Discover the Tanabe.TV Dumkudo Drive, an overdrive effects pedal that brings a touch of precision and versatility to your guitar sound. This pedal is a favorite among guitarists seeking dynamic tonal variety and the ability to craft everything from subtle, bluesy warmth to aggressive, powerful overdrive. The Dumkudo Drive is crafted by hand in Japan, which ensures meticulous attention to detail and outstanding build quality. Its unique three-way mode switch offers distinct tonal options: Dumble, Marshall, and Zen settings, each providing a different sonic character to match your playing style.
This pedal is particularly lauded for its responsive touch sensitivity and clarity. As you adjust your playing dynamics, the Dumkudo Drive responds in kind, maintaining articulation and richness in every note. The intuitive layout allows for easy tweaking of the gain, tone, and volume controls, giving you the flexibility to shape your sound effortlessly during live performances or studio sessions.
The Dumkudo Drive is more than just an overdrive pedal; it’s a gateway to a diverse sound palette that can satisfy any guitarist's demands, from jazz to rock to blues. Whether you're looking to add a subtle edge to your clean tones or push your amp into gritty overdrive, this pedal is designed to enhance your musical expression with precision and depth.

Three OD Pedals in One Box, Sounds Killer!
From light overdrive, to thicker gain sounds nearing distortion, the Dumkudo is the best OD pedal I've ever played. It's natural amp-like feel is so nice to have in a pedal when you rely on nothing but a pedal for your grit sounds. It can go from a Dumble amp sounds to Marshall plexi'sh sounds. Put a boost pedal in front and you can get thick buttery distorted tones out of it. On the side of the pedal is a 3 position switch that changes the character of the overdrive, thusly, three OD pedals in one box.

In a tweet, Wes Hauch mentions that the Tanabe.TV Dumkudo Drive pedal is "putting in work," indicating his personal use of this overdrive effects pedal.
Artur Menezes is featured using the Tanabe.TV Dumkudo Drive overdrive pedal in an article by Pedais e Efeitos, highlighting its role in his guitar setup.
